I have received the second Interim Report of the Commission of Investigation into Mother and Baby Homes.
I have already committed to publishing the Report. The report has been prepared to address the requirement in its terms of reference for the Commission to report on any additional matters which it considers may warrant further investigation in the public interest as part of its work.
Since receiving the Report I have met with the Commission to discuss the Report and the general progress being made with the investigation.
Given the broad scope of the Commission's work a number of issues in the Report extend beyond the remit of the Department of Children and Youth Affairs. For this reason, it has been necessary to take some time to consult with Cabinet colleagues and the Attorney General on these matters. I have recently sought some additional information from the Commission to assist in these deliberations. My intention is to publish the Report in conjunction with Government's response to the Commission's findings.
I am sensitive to the concerns and expectations of former residents and I hope to conclude this process as quickly as possible. As I have done previously, arrangements will be made to inform representative groups of any developments before making a public announcement.
